Ian 'motm' Hardy was put on the bench at Extra Salt, according to HLTV. Instead, the team will collaborate with Edgar 'MarKE' Maldonado.
Former Chaos Esports Club player has been left behind since the team's disband last year. Edgar's two former teammates went to Valorant, and Eric 'Xeppaa' Bach went to Cloud9 while Jonathan 'Jonji' Carey began building the new Bad News Bears roster.
Playing for Extra Salt, motm performed well and played with an average rating of 1.08. The team recently made it to DreamHack Open January 2021 and finished in third place (out of four) in the American division after losing twice to Rebirth Esports.
Updated roaster Extra Salt
- Johnny 'JT' Teodosiu
- Aran 'Sonic' Groesbeek
- Josh 'oSee' Ohm
- Justin 'FaNg' Cockley
- Edgar 'MarKE' Maldonado
- Tiaan 'Tc' Cortzen (coach)
- Ian 'motm' Hardy (reserve)
